Module Name:    src
Committed By:   matt
Date:           Tue Feb  8 06:22:29 UTC 2011

Modified Files:
        src/sys/arch/evbppc/conf: files.mpc85xx
        src/sys/arch/evbppc/mpc85xx: machdep.c

Log Message:
Add MPC85xx variants.
Move to having a common kernel for all MPC85xx variants (CADMUS/PIXIS still
remain a problem).
